Martita de Graná arrives in Barcelona after an entire tour of “Mi padre flipa”, a little tired of repeating the same text over and over again on stage. She feels that Barcelona will recharge her batteries to recover her spark and that staying here will give her career a new dimension, especially since she is not very sure what will become of her when the tour ends. But it does not work.
In the city, her plans are truncated: surrounded by posturing, she believes she is not up to the task, and she will make an effort to fit into an environment radically different from her own, leaving behind her life and her Granada customs. A monumental error that will block her even more.
